解析DApp与以太坊钱包的区别:功能、应用与用户
随着区块链技术的快速发展,去中心化应用程序(DApp)与以太坊钱包成为了这一领域的两个关键概念。许多用户在了解区块链和加密货币的同时,对于这两个概念的功能及应用场景并不十分清晰。本文将全面解析DApp与以太坊钱包之间的区别,帮助读者更好地理解这两个重要组成部分在区块链世界中的角色。
一、DApp的概念与特征
DApp是“去中心化应用程序”(Decentralized Application)的缩写,它不仅仅是一个应用程序,更是基于区块链技术构建的一种新型应用。DApp通常运行在去中心化的网络上,例如以太坊、EOS等,利用智能合约来实现去中心化的特性。
其特征包括:
- 去中心化:DApp没有中心化的服务器,各个用户共同维护网络。
- 开放源码:绝大多数DApp都是开源的,任何人都可以查看、使用或改进其代码。
- 智能合约:DApp利用智能合约来实现自动化执行和保证透明性。
- 激励机制:DApp通常会采用代币经济模型来激励用户参与并维持网络的稳定与安全。
二、以太坊钱包的概念与功能
以太坊钱包是用于存储、发送和接收以太坊(ETH)及其代币(如ERC-20代币)的一种软件工具。以太坊钱包可以是软件形式的,如桌面钱包、移动钱包,也可以是硬件形式的,如Ledger等冷钱包。
以太坊钱包的主要功能包括:
- 资产管理:用户可以在钱包中方便地管理自己的以太坊及代币资产。
- 交易记录:以太坊钱包记录所有的交易信息,方便用户查询。
- 与DApp交互:用户可以通过以太坊钱包与各种去中心化应用程序进行交互。
- 安全性:优秀的钱包具备高水平的安全性,保障用户的资产安全。
三、DApp与以太坊钱包的主要区别
虽然DApp和以太坊钱包都与以太坊生态系统相关,但它们之间的功能和目标截然不同:
- 功能差异:DApp是应用程序,旨在提供特定的服务或功能,例如去中心化交易、博彩、社交等;而以太坊钱包是资产管理工具,致力于安全地存储和转移以太坊及其代币。
- 用户交互:用户通过钱包与DApp进行交互,从而完成特定业务;而DApp用户则使用钱包来管理它们的加密资产。
- 开发方式:DApp通常由开发团队创建和维护,而以太坊钱包则由独立的开发者和团队构建并提供给公众使用。
- 存在形态:DApp存储在区块链上,每个用户都可以用去中心化的方式访问,而以太坊钱包往往是客户端下载的辅助工具,用户的私钥、钱包数据也是保存在本地设备中。
四、DApp与以太坊钱包的应用场景
在实际应用中,DApp和以太坊钱包扮演着不同的角色。
对于DApp来说,其应用场景非常广泛。例如,去中心化金融(DeFi)应用允许用户进行借贷、交易、流动性挖矿等操作;去中心化市场(如OpenSea)使用户能够安全交易数字资产;而去中心化社交平台可以让用户自由表达创作,获得直接的经济收益。
而以太坊钱包则是这些应用的入口。用户通过钱包与DApp进行连接,例如连接MetaMask等浏览器扩展钱包,用户可以方便地访问并使用各种DApp,同时管理自己的数字资产。
问题讨论
1. DApp如何影响传统应用的未来?
随着越来越多的DApp进入市场,它们开始逐步挑战传统应用的地位。首先,DApp的去中心化特性使得它们更具安全性和透明性,能够防止中介操作带来的风险。此外,DApp往往提供更低的费用,因为它们省去了中介的需求,用户可以直接进行交易或交互。
同时,DApp亦鼓励用户的参与感,因为他们可能在应用中有直接的经济利益。在传统应用中,用户的数据被集中在企业手中,而DApp往往更重视用户隐私,相较于传统应用,DApp提供了更多控制权与收益机会。
当然,DApp的发展也面临不少挑战,包括用户体验不佳、技术理解门槛等,但随着技术的不断成熟,这些问题有望逐步得到解决。未来,DApp可能会对比传统应用带来更为根本的变革,尤其是在金融、社交、游戏等领域。
2. 如何选择安全的以太坊钱包?
选择一个安全的以太坊钱包至关重要,因为钱包的安全性直接关系到用户资产的安全。首先,需要确认钱包的开发团队是否有良好的声誉,并查看用户的评测和反馈。一个受到广泛认可的钱包通常更能保证安全性。
其次,要确保钱包支持控制私钥,最好选择一种支持用户自我控制私钥的钱包。这样即便是钱包公司在某种情况下被攻破,用户的资产依然能够获得保护。同时,硬件钱包相较于软件钱包来说,具备更高的安全性,尤其是存储较多资产的用户,可以考虑使用硬件钱包。
另外,用户在使用以太坊钱包时务必要开启双重验证,定期更新密码,并使用强密码。此外,应定期备份助记词,防止因设备损失导致资产无法找回。总之,保障钱包安全的关键在于用户的日常使用习惯以及对安全措施的重视。
3. DApp和以太坊钱包的使用步骤有哪些?
使用DApp和以太坊钱包的步骤其实相辅相成,用户通常需要先下载一个以太坊钱包,然后才能访问DApp。
首先,用户可以从官方网站或各大应用商店下载所选择的钱包,并进行注册和设置。随后,用户需创建或导入钱包账号,并妥善保护助记词,因为这是用户找回资产的唯一方式。
完成钱包的设置后,用户需要为其钱包充值以太坊或相应的代币。充值方式可以选择通过交易所直接购买,或通过其他用户进行转账。接下来,用户可以根据自己的需求,通过浏览器访问相应的DApp,连接自己的以太坊钱包。大部分DApp都支持与主流钱包的连接,如MetaMask、Trust Wallet等。
在使用DApp时,用户需要仔细阅读合约条款,理解相关费用,再进行交互。在交易完成后,用户可以在钱包中查看交易记录与余额,确保资产的安全和透明。
4. DApp和以太坊钱包的未来发展趋势
未来,DApp和以太坊钱包都有着广阔的发展前景。随着区块链技术的进一步成熟,DApp的应用场景将更加多样化,可能会出现更多创新的去中心化应用,覆盖金融、社交、游戏等多个领域。
同时,随着用户对数字资产和隐私保护意识的提升,安全性和易用性兼备的以太坊钱包将更加受到青睐。对于钱包的需求将不仅限于资产的管理,未来的以太坊钱包可能会集成更丰富的功能,如跨链支持、DApp浏览器等,从而为用户提供更为便利的操作体验。
此外,随着监管政策的逐步明确以及市场的成熟,更多的传统企业将可能加入DApp和以太坊钱包的生态,推动整个行业的健康发展。最终,DApp和以太坊钱包的结合将促进去中心化经济的发展,使用户在享有更高参与度的同时,有机会实现对自身数据和资产的更好控制。
总之,DApp与以太坊钱包的相互依存与联动,将在未来的区块链生态中形成紧密联系,为用户提供更为安全、便利的数字资产管理和应用体验。